Introducing the Tiji Celebration: A Celebration Steeped in Practice
The Tiji Event, likewise known as "Tempa Chirim" which equates to "Prayer for Globe Tranquility," is a distinct party unique to Lo Manthang, the resources of Upper Mustang. Held according to the Tibetan lunar calendar, the celebration generally falls in mid-May. Mark your calendars, because the Tiji Celebration for 2025 will occur from May 24th to May 26th.

The celebration revolves around the tale of Dorjee Sonnu, an version of Lord Buddha, that vanquishes a malevolent devil called Guy Tam Ru. Via covered up dancings, colorful outfits, and captivating routines, the locals reenact this epic fight, looking for true blessings for peace, success, and a abundant harvest.

Beyond the Jeep: Important Tips for Your Tiji Celebration Experience.
Here are some additional tips to guarantee a smooth and enriching Tiji Event experience:.

Authorizations and Laws: Upper Mustang requires special permits for foreigners. Guarantee your trip driver manages all necessary documentation.
Loading Essentials: Pack for high altitudes with warm clothes, comfortable shoes, sun block, a hat, and a excellent cam.
